※参考情報 自動車用シート角度調整モーターは、乗用車や商用車のシートの角度を調整するための電動機構です。この装置は、運転中の快適性を向上させるために重要な役割を果たしています。シートのポジションは、運転者や乗客の体型や運転スタイルによって異なるため、個々のニーズに応じて調整可能であることが求められます。これにより、長時間の運転でも疲労を軽減し、安全性を高めることができます。 自動車用シート角度調整モーターは、一般的にDCモーターやステッピングモーターが使用されます。これらのモーターは、適切なトルクと回転速度を提供し、シートの位置をスムーズに調整できるよう設計されています。DCモーターは、特に制御が容易で、コンパクトな設計が可能なため、多くの車両に広く採用されています。一方、ステッピングモーターは精密な位置制御が可能で、特にリクライニング機構など微細な調整が求められる場合に利用されます。 シート角度調整モーターの主な特徴は、そのコンパクトさと高効率です。現代の自動車においては、限られたスペースを有効に活用するため、モーターは小型でありながら強力な性能を持つことが要求されます。また、多くのモーターは耐久性にも優れ、車両の振動や衝撃に耐えるよう設計されています。さらに、一部のモデルでは静音性が求められ、運転中の快適性を損なわないよう配慮されています。 用途面では、シートの前後移動、リクライニング(背もたれの角度調整)、シートの高さ調整など、多岐にわたります。これにより、運転者や乗客は自身の体型や好みに応じたポジションを確保でき、乗り心地の向上が図られます。また、電動式の調整により、より簡単に、迅速に調整を行えるため、高齢者や障害者を含むすべてのユーザーにとっての利便性も向上します。 関連技術としては、電子制御ユニット(ECU)が挙げられます。このユニットは、シートの角度調整に必要な信号を生成し、モーターの動作を制御します。近年では、スマートフォンアプリと連携してシートポジションを記憶・調整するシステムや、自動運転技術との連携によりシートの位置を最適化する機能も考案されています。これにより、自動車のユーザーエクスペリエンスがさらに向上することが期待されます。 技術の進化に伴い、シート角度調整モーターも常に進化しており、新材料の使用や、省エネルギー化が進められています。これにより、搭載重量の削減や燃費向上が図られ、環境負荷の低減にも貢献しています。 このように、自動車用シート角度調整モーターは、運転者や乗客の快適性と安全性を向上させるための重要な要素であり、今後も技術革新が続くことで、更なる利便性が期待されます。人間工学に基づいた設計や、ユーザーのニーズを的確に反映するための機能が求められる中、今後も自動車産業の発展に寄与し続けるでしょう。自動車用シート角度調整モーターの進化は、快適なドライブ体験をさらに豊かにする要素となっています。 |
